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> Wygenerowanie zawartości tabeli, kolumna `numer`- od 00000000 do 99999999, losowo, ale bez powtórzeń
SLimiX
post 10.12.2009, 00:19:14
Post #1





Grupa: Zarejestrowani
Postów: 1
Pomógł: 0
Dołączył: 19.06.2005

Ostrzeżenie: (0%)
-----


Witam, chce stworzyć tabele która będzie miała następujące kolumny

  1. CREATE TABLE `tabela` (
  2. `id` int NOT NULL AUTO_INCREMENT,
  3. `numer` int
  4. PRIMARY KEY (`id`)
  5. )
  6. TYPE=MyISAM AUTO_INCREMENT=3;


Chciałbym wygenerować tabele w której od razu były by:
`id` - od 1 do 99999999 #czy w ogolę mogę wygenerować tak dużą ilość rekordów?
`numer`- od 00000000 do 99999999, #ale tak by nie były poukładane po kolei i się nie powtarzały.

Jestem baardzo początkujący w MySQL, więc proszę o wyrozumiałość. winksmiley.jpg Uczę się z w3schools, a tam odpowiedzi nie znalazłem. Google też nie pomaga. ;/

Da się to zrobić za pomocą MySQL?
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
someone.cool
post 10.12.2009, 02:09:59
Post #2





Grupa: Zarejestrowani
Postów: 50
Pomógł: 1
Dołączył: 31.01.2009

Ostrzeżenie: (0%)
-----


dobre pytanie Mchl.
może po to, żeby zapchać komuś bazę ? winksmiley.jpg

Cytat(SLimiX @ 10.12.2009, 00:19:14 ) *
#czy w ogolę mogę wygenerować tak dużą ilość rekordów?


- 2 147 483 648 - 2 147 483 648 = to zakres inta -> UNSIGNED to 2x wiecej -> 0- 4 294 967 296. Ty chcesz "tylko" 99 999 999 -> WEJDZIE biggrin.gif


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Wersja Lo-Fi Aktualny czas: 14.08.2025 - 21:09